Nehemiah Action

Pastor Bobby speaking at FAST Nehemiah Action Meeting

FAST, which stands for Faith and Action for Strength Together is a social justice ministry which fits perfectly into Maximo’s commitment to being a Matthew 25 church. This year’s FAST Committees in this area have been working very hard on Affordable Housing, Water Quality and Worsening Flooding, and Criminal Justice Reform.  Thank you to Kathy Calcaterra for your leadership and thank you to all the Maximo Church Members who attended this powerful meeting.

PC(USA) updated Daily Prayer App now available

An updated version of the PC(USA)’s Daily Prayer app is now available for Apple, Android and Amazon devices! The Daily Prayer app provides brief services for daily prayer, including psalms for the day, readings from the daily lectionary, and prayers of thanksgiving and intercession.
